For John the Baptizer came neither eating bread nor drinking wine, and you say, 'He has a demon.' The Son of Man has come eating and drinking, and you say, 'Behold, a gluttonous man, and a drunkard; a friend of tax collectors and sinners!' Luke 7:33'34 WEB.A gloomy feeling settled over you when you entered the church sanctuary. Everyone was somber, with long faces like they were mourning, but it wasn't a funeral. The elders certainly looked elderly. The paintings of Jesus on the wall always made Him look sad. Either He was a baby in a manger or bleeding out on a cross. This church was cold, quiet, and highly religious. It was institutionalized religion at its finest, and the denomination was basically a franchise.
When I read my Bible, I couldn't help but think, "We seem to be missing something." Jesus lived a colorful, full, happy life. He laughed with people, He loved, He wept. Jesus had friends. He fasted often, but at other times, He ate very well. The Pharisees stood outside and watched Him feast with tax collectors and sinners (Matthew 9:11). Yet, they felt too holy to go inside themselves. They stood outside feeling holier than the Lord Jesus Christ.
Jesus gave His disciples nicknames like the "Sons of Thunder" (Mark 3:17) when James and John wanted to call down fire from heaven. He rejoiced in the Holy Spirit (Luke 10:21). The kingdom of God is righteousness, peace, and joy in the Holy Spirit (Romans 14:17), and Jesus walked in that realm. The joy of the Lord is our strength (Nehemiah 8:10), and I am sure that Jesus was strong.
The great reformer Martin Luther became a monk. He wore himself out praying to saints, fasting, and confessing sins to his superiors. Yet, it gave him no peace. Then he found true grace, left monkery, married a nun, and changed the known world. Luther raised ten children and concluded that "Marriage is a far better school for character than any monastery."
The Lord Jesus Christ wants you to live a full and wonderful life just as He did. There will be times of laughing and times of weeping. There will be times of fasting and times of feasting. There is a time to be born and a time to die. So allow room for joy in your life, and balance the drudgery. Don't allow cold, dead religion to sap the joy from your life, for it was God who invented blue skies and sunshine.
